Ages of Conflict is primarily a "god-sim." You act as an observer (or a chaotic deity) in a massive free-for-all where randomized nations interact, form alliances, and wage war. Ages of Conflict Wiki Key features that draw players in include: Dynamic Diplomacy: Nations don't just fight; they form complex alliances and experience economic shifts that can turn the tide of a century-long war. Infinite Variety: The game can generate an endless number of random worlds, or you can use custom maps to recreate historical conflicts or fantasy scenarios. God Mode: While the AI runs the show, you can intervene by buffing certain nations, changing borders, or forcing peace treaties. Ages of Conflict is a versatile Map Simulation game. Unlike traditional strategy games where you control a single faction, here you are the observer (or the "World Creator"). You can spawn nations, force them into alliances, trigger massive wars, or simply let the AI run wild to see which country eventually conquers the globe.
